A man rolls dough out with a glass bottle. A woman and a boy put rolled-out dough over the bottoms of large clay pots called ollas, covered with cloths. The woman lays the dough out on the table. A man pulls the fried bunuelos out of pots of hot oil. Bunuelos are cooking in the oil. A woman grabs stacks bunuelos and places them in a bowl then drizzles pink liquid over them and sprinkles sugar on top. She sells the bunuelos to customers at a street stand. People throw bowls down to the ground breaking them following tradition. A band plays outside under twinkling lights as people cheer.
